Sadus Fire Drummer Jon Allen Following Abuse Allegations

Sadus have parted ways with Jon Allen. The drummer was fired following some disturbing abuse allegations.

Vocalist/guitarist Darren Travis commented:

“Upon recent allegations of misconduct.. SADUS will be parting ways with Jon Allen.. I do not condone any type of malicious behavior towards any person. Darren Travis / SADUS“

Allen was accused of being physically abusive to his significant other Brandy Mae Collins, who suffers from chronic illness. The allegations were highlighted by Anubis vocalist/bassist Devin Riche, who has voiced support for Collins, while also sharing a collection of disturbing photos and footage.
